They arrived today. And as the temperature/time indicator shows they were stored in a climate controlled warehouse and are in perfect condition. The inner dot is the same color as the outside of the circle.

If they would have been stored in a hot warehouse the center red dot would darken. http://nsrdec.natick.army.mil/media/..._Indicator.pdf
